Petcetera could easily make the right decision

With 17 stores in BC inclusive of 11 in the Lower Mainland the number of baby rabbits bought on impulse is staggering. It's kept the breeders in business and condemned thousands upon thousands of these "pets" to a miserable existence. Petcetera could easily make the right decision and stop its sales not only in BC but across Canada as well. If enough concerns are raised, and the bottom line impacted, there would be change.
